WebApr 12, 2024 · The most difficult site, requiring substantial excavation, is flat. A moderate slope takes more excavation than a steep one. Soil. The ideal types for bermed Earth-sheltering are granular soils like sand and gravel. These soils are relatively permeable, allowing water to drain quickly and compact well to support the weight of the building ... WebOct 4, 2024 · Heaving and slope instability. ... Various kinds of drains which commonly used in earth dams are given below: Rock Toe. In this arrangement stone size which varying from 15 cm to 20 cm is arranged in the downstream toe end of the dam. It is arranged graded in layers which consist of fine sand, coarse sand, and gravel as shown …
